Weather you are a solo Traveler or on a holiday with family, beautiful beaches here are one of the reasons you want to stay here. Dubai offers both kind of beaches Paid and Free. Paid beaches are of Hotels and Parks. The beaches here are very broad and sand here is soft and shining. Also Beaches In Dubai are clean and perfectly safe as other parts of Dubai. A word of advice, always wear proper full swimsuit while you are beach. Wearing beach costume and roaming at other public places which are not part of actual beaches is strictly prohibited. 1. Mamzer Beach Park:

The beach had been awarded blue flag beach status is massive and clean. It is very popular between residents and tourist here, termed as most desirable beach of Dubai. The beach has sheltered area and Shower rooms. You can also rent chalets here with barbecue area. The lifeguards are on duty and flag warning system.

2. Jumeirah Beach Park:

It is the one of the most popular beach in Dubai due to its easily approachable location. The Park has beautiful fine golden sand, Palm trees and Grassy area. You can find kiosk and cafe at the ends of beach. The Dubai Tourism Department has given lot of awards to this beach for maintaining its standards.

3. Russian Beach:

It is at the opposite of Burj Al Arab. It got its name because this is the place where majority of Russians and European use to hangout. This beach is not developed as others are but it’s nearby to some good cafes and Malls. You will find lot of joggers and cyclers hopping around.

4. Kite Beach:

Also known as Wollongong Beach is Kite surfer’s paradise. It is a nice place to fly kite or jut sit back, relax and watch other kite lovers flying kites. The beach has no facility so don’t forget to bring some snacks while coming here.
